Multimicrophone Based Speech Dereverberation

2018
Speech signal received by distant microphones in real environments contains reverberation and noise. This deteriorates the quality of received signal. However to improve the speech quality, it is essential to remove reverberation and noise. The process of removing reverberation and reproducing original speech is called dereverberation.

Cepstrum-based deconvolution for speech dereverberation

IEEE Transactions on Speech and Audio Processing, 1996
We present a blind deconvolution-based approach for the restoration of speech degraded by the acoustic environment. The proposed scheme processes the outputs of two microphones using cepstra operations and the theory of signal reconstruction from phase only.

Study on Speech Dereverberation with Autocorrelation Codebook

2007 IEEE International Conference on Acoustics, Speech and Signal Processing - ICASSP '07, 2007
This paper proposes a new speech dereverberation approach based on a statistical speech model. An autocorrelation codebook is introduced as a model that can represent time-varying short-time speech characteristics corresponding to the cepstrum and harmonics.

A Novel Approach for Dereverberation of Speech Signals

2019 13th International Conference on Signal Processing and Communication Systems (ICSPCS), 2019
In this paper, we propose a novel higher-order statistics based approach to estimate the room impulse response (RIR) of a reverberating auditorium. The RIR is then used to dereverberate the speech signal. It is assumed that the RIR does not change for a brief period of time called the coherence time.

Speech dereverberation based on a recorded handclap

2011 17th International Conference on Digital Signal Processing (DSP), 2011
A semi-blind framework for the suppression of late speech reverberation is presented. The method is based on spectral subtraction and utilizes a simple recorded handclap to estimate the Power Spectral Density (PSD) of late reverberation. Iterative cepstrum-based approach for speech dereverberation

ISSPA '99. Proceedings of the Fifth International Symposium on Signal Processing and its Applications (IEEE Cat. No.99EX359), 2003
This paper presents a novel approach for dereverberation of speech signals, based on an iterative cepstral separation of the non-minimum phase room response.
